Output 5403c328802d133dd62897ac9acef48e989a864b3482a1f78fd93ec20d5c9614:2

value
27248830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09ab51099d3516ea0a12bdabd7654a37a1091f8 OP_EQUAL
address
MSvA7agQ1yTWMbRJyguKJeJAfgJhLQk2KH
transaction
5403c328802d133dd62897ac9acef48e989a864b3482a1f78fd93ec20d5c9614
spent
true